Summary:

The super heroes have fallen. The country has been divided into territories controlled by super villains. Among the wastelands lives Clint Barton-- one of the few Avengers to survive. But it's been 45 years, and he's no Avenger. Trying to eke out a living any way he can, the former Hawkeye is confronted with a startling discovery: the sharpshooter is going blind. With time running short, Clint realizes there's one last thing he wants to see: revenge for his fallen comrades-in-arms. A story set five years before the original classic Old Man Logan.
